Clear an app's cache: Go to Settings > Apps > pick an app > Storage > Clear cache. Clear the system cache: Open the Android recovery menu and select Wipe cache partition. Deleting these caches is useful if your phone is running slowly or you're nearly out of space to save other files.

May 18, 2022 · Clear individual apps cache on Android. If you want to clear the cache data of a specific app, you can do so by: Going to Settings, and tapping Apps. Tap on the app that you want to clear. Tap Clear Cache, located near the bottom of the screen. Clear app cache in settings.
